Picture editing software: iBatch 1.3
Press release Now iBatch 1.3 additionally can "implant" an EXIF-header in converted picture files. iBatch uses the new plugin "jhead-capsule" (screenshot).

If there is not an original EXIF-header, the plugin tries to create a new EXIF-header from the information provided by iBatch.

AmigaOS 4 / MorphOS: Word Me Up XXL 1.4
The commercial game "Word Me Up XXL" published by Boing Attitude combines arcade and puzzle elements and is available for AmigaOS 4 and MorphOS in version 1.4. Both demo versions with four of the 60 levels have been updated as well.

Changes:
  • Various graphical enhancements:
    • All individuals have been redrawn (characters, enemies)
    • All graphical themes have been enhanced
  • Better collision detection (with objects and water)

Aminet domain registration expired, Aminet temporarily not available (Update 2)
The Aminet team informs us: Due to an unfortunate oversight, the registration für the domain aminet.net has expired - that's why Aminet is currently not available at that address. The owner of the domain, Urban Müller, has been notified and will fix the problem as soon as possible.

We will announce a replacement URL as soon as it has been established (i.e. as soon as the server admin has returned home). The IP of the Aminet main server is 69.163.220.116, but you'll have to modify your computer's hosts file if you want to use this IP.

Note: Aminet and all of its mirrors continue to exist and are not in danger of being shut down. We're already witnessing users announcing they're making backups "for safety reasons" - please do not do that, you're only wasting server ressources donated to Aminet by private users, non-profit organisations and universities.

Update: (21.08.2011, 16:45, cg)

Amiga user LoadWB managed to convince our provider to reenable the domain for now, until the registration has been renewed.

Update: (21.08.2011, 23:30, cg)

Domain registration has been properly renewed a few hours ago. It may take a few more hours until all DNS servers worldwide have updated their databases accordingly, but tomorrow afternoon evernbody should be able to access Aminet again. (cg) (Translation: cg)
